#2b0a7d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#2b0a7d is composed of 16.9% red, 3.9% green and 49%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 65.6% cyan, 92% magenta, 0% yellow and 51% black. It has a hue angle of 257.2 degrees, a saturation of 85.2% and a lightness of 26.5%. #2b0a7d color hex could be obtained by blending #5614fa with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#330066.

#2b0a7d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#2b0a7d has RGB values of R:43, G:10, B:125 and CMYK values of C:0.66, M:0.92, Y:0, K:0.51. Its decimal value is 2820733.
